#c631bc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#c631bc is composed of 77.6% red, 19.2% green and 73.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 75.3% magenta, 5.1% yellow and 22.4% black. It has a hue angle of 304 degrees, a saturation of 60.3% and a lightness of 48.4%. #c631bc color hex could be obtained by blending #ff62ff with #8d0079. Closest websafe color is: #cc33cc.

#c631bc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#c631bc has RGB values of R:198, G:49, B:188 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.75, Y:0.05, K:0.22. Its decimal value is 12988860.

Shades and Tints of #c631bc

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090209 is the darkest color, while #fdf9f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#c631bc

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#847482 is the less saturated color, while #f601e5 is the most saturated one.
